Thermal Management
Let's find out what TDP value would be better for MediaTek MT8321 or Intel Celeron N4100? The Thermal Design Power (TDP) indicates the maximum amount of heat that should be dissipated by the chip cooling system. However, the value of TDP gives only a rough indication of the real power consumption of the CPU.
